Why does the job exist?
Secretarial staff are responsible for receptionist duties at the front desk (answering phones, interacting with the public and looking up information in database). Secretarial staff are also responsible for data entry of law enforcement police reports into the system. Secretarial staff are responsible for file room, creating new files for clients and making sure files are merged when needed.
How does it get done?
This position will enter police reports received from law enforcement into the Family Automated Client Tracking System {FACTS) database. This position will also be responsible for sealing of youth records when necessary. This position willing enter court paperwork into FACTS within one business day of receipt including detention/warrant arraignments. Maintain calendars, schedules, and coordinate appointments, meetings, training. Support new employees with completing forms and enrolling in necessary trainings. Assist Chief JPO with the district budget, and other clerical duties.

Working Conditions
Work is performed in an office setting and consists of sitting for extended periods of time, extensive computer use, typing, lifting, bending and use of other office equipment including copy machines and fax machines. Some travel may be required.
